Output f3b95cb2962eeb99de90076858d0ad30fe1ee32d226623a0d9d9eea8941310e7:2

value
89408
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c08a891179f3cd26f442d62ed75ebab967ebbdfb81ce4856b1e5adac37311c3
address
bc1p8sy23yghnu7dym6y943w6a0t4wt8aw7lhqwwfpttredd4smnz8psfl2yt9
transaction
f3b95cb2962eeb99de90076858d0ad30fe1ee32d226623a0d9d9eea8941310e7
confirmations
75752
spent
true